The invention provides a method for determining a preview point of an automatic driving automobile. The method comprises the following steps: acquiring information of an ideal tracking path of the automobile and current state information of the automobile; determining a preview distance according to the current speed information of the vehicle and the preview time; taking the coordinate of the current position of the vehicle as a reference, and determining a point closest to the vehicle position in the ideal path as a search starting point; determining an interval where the preview point is located; determining whether the current driving road of the vehicle is a straight road or a curve; and determining the preview point. The method is carried out in a geodetic coordinate system, the calculation mode is simple, the calculated amount is small, and effective support can be provided for selection of preview points; according to the method, the turning driving distance of the vehicle is fully reserved, and a good tracking effect on the curve track of the vehicle is achieved; the preview point determined by the method provided by the invention is reliable in result, the accuracy of theintelligent driving path tracking module can be improved, and the driving stability of the vehicle on a straight road and a curve is ensured; the calculation amount of the algorithm is greatly reduced, and the algorithm efficiency is improved.
